Passionate about technical growing and ready to continue your career with one of the UK's largest ornamental growers?

Due to continued expansion, they're looking for an Assistant Technical Manager to join the team. As the business grows, there's real potential for internal promotion and career development.

You'll be based at their largest site (70 acres), where you'll take ownership of all things crop health - a brilliant opportunity to make the role your own.

The Role

Reporting to the Technical Manager, you'll be supported by someone who's happy to guide and develop you. While they'll focus on the other sites, you'll lead the charge at their main site- giving you plenty of autonomy and responsibility.

While there are no direct reports, you'll work closely with a team of six growers, supporting and advising them on plant health and crop protection programmes.

Key Responsibilities Include:

Implement and review crop protection, fungicide, and herbicide programmes for indoor and outdoor crops.

  • Monitor pest, disease, and weed pressure through regular crop walks
  • Support and train the growing team in crop walking and plant health monitoring
  • Manage the chemical store, order stock, and ensure compliance with storage and application regulations
  • Keep accurate records in line with audit and quality schemes
  • Lead biocontrol programmes and support trials (e.g. biopesticides, biostimulants)
  • Act as point of contact for technical queries and APHA inspections

About You

  • You have experience in crop protection and growing - this could be in ornamentals or edible crops.
    Comfortable with crop walking and developing action plans and working in a hands-on role.
  • Strong knowledge of plant health, compliance, and chemical/biological applications
  • Ideally hold PA1 and PA6 - but training will be offered for the right person.
